Our Team
The Bloomberg Data AI group brings cutting‑edge AI technologies into Bloomberg’s Data organization, supplying deep domain expertise to the development of AI‑powered products. One of our key focus areas supports compliance monitoring and supervision through structured annotation of electronic communications. These annotations underpin critical policy controls, model training, and enrichment pipelines that enhance compliance coverage, communication understanding, and risk detection. Our team builds and manages scalable annotation frameworks and governance systems that help ensure compliant, high‑quality datasets. We partner closely with Compliance, Product, and Engineering to design annotation guidelines, establish review and escalation protocols, and ensure alignment with evolving regulatory and internal policies.
What’s The Role
As a member of the Query Enrichment team, you will help make Bloomberg’s GenAI capabilities smarter, faster, and more intuitive. Our work connects data science, natural language processing, and human judgment — enriching queries to ensure users receive the most accurate and relevant responses possible. We partner closely with other Data teams, as well as Product and Engineering to enhance the intelligence behind Bloomberg’s AI offering.
